Once you have both the weapon and passive item, defeat any boss monster after you’ve survived for at least 10 minutes, and pick up the chest to evolve your weapon. Once you do that, you’ll also need the matching passive item in your inventory as well, though it doesn’t need to be level 8, save for special combinations. Evolving weapons is the key to hitting huge power spikes with your character, so we’ll walk you through the process.įirst off, you need to upgrade your weapon to level 8.
